Understanding Platform Security and Licensing

When choosing an online gaming platform, the first and foremost concern should be security. Reputable platforms invest heavily in robust security measures to protect user data and financial transactions. Look for sites that utilize SSL encryption, which creates a secure connection between your device and the platform’s servers, preventing unauthorized access to your information. Security audits conducted by independent third-party organizations are also a strong indicator of a platform's commitment to safety. These audits assess the platform’s security protocols and ensure they meet industry standards. Examining the site’s privacy policy is another critical step; it should clearly outline how your data is collected, used, and protected.

Beyond technical security, licensing is a crucial aspect of ensuring a platform's legitimacy. Platforms operating legally are required to obtain licenses from recognized regulatory bodies, such as the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C). These licenses signify that the platform has met stringent requirements related to fairness, security, and responsible gambling. A valid license demonstrates accountability and provides a recourse for players in case of disputes. Before engaging with any online gaming site, always verify its licensing information. This information is typically displayed prominently on the platform's website, often in the footer. Checking the regulator's website to confirm the validity of the license is also a wise precaution.

The Importance of Two-Factor Authentication

In addition to the platform's security measures, individual users can enhance their own security by enabling two-factor authentication (2FA). 2FA adds an extra layer of protection by requiring a second verification method, such as a code sent to your mobile device, in addition to your password. This makes it significantly more difficult for unauthorized individuals to access your account, even if they manage to obtain your password. Most reputable online gaming platforms offer 2FA as an option, and it is strongly recommended to enable it whenever available. Consider using a strong, unique password for each of your online accounts, and avoid reusing passwords across multiple platforms, as that creates a single point of failure.

Responsible Gaming Practices and Self-Control

While online gaming can be a fun and entertaining pastime, it’s essential to approach it responsibly. One of the most important aspects of responsible gaming is setting limits – both time and financial. Determine how much time and money you are willing to spend on gaming each week or month and stick to those limits. Many platforms offer tools to help you manage your spending,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Deposit limits restrict the amount of money you can deposit into your account within a specific timeframe. Loss limits cap the amount of money you can lose over a certain period. Self-exclusion allows you to temporarily or permanently block yourself from accessing the platform.

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is crucial for both yourself and others. These signs may include spending more time and money on gaming than intended, chasing losses, lying about your gaming habits, or experiencing negative consequences in other areas of your life, such as relationships or work.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, there are resources available to help. Organizations like GamCare and BeGambleAware offer confidential support and guidance. Remember, se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ness. Maintaining a healthy balance between gaming and other activities is vital for overall well-being.

Understanding Bonus Offers and Wagering Requirements

Online gaming platforms fr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These bonuses can take many forms, such as wel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ty rewards. While bonuses can be enticing, it’s crucial to understand the terms and conditions that apply to them, particularly wagering requirements. Wagering requirements specify the amount of money you must wager before you can withdraw any winnings earned from the b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you must wager 30 times the bonus amount before you can withdraw your winnings. Some offers may also have restrictions on the types of games you can play with the bonus funds.

Carefully reading the terms and conditions of any bonus offer before accepting it is essential. Pay attention to the wagering requirements, game restrictions, time limits, and maximum win limits. Understanding these terms will help you avoid disappointment and ensure that you can actually benefit from the bonus. Evaluating the Value of a Bonus

Not all bonuses are created equal. The value of a bonus depends on several factors, including the bonus amount, the wagering requirements, and the game restrictions. A large bonus with high wagering requirements may be less valuable than a smaller bonus with lower wagering requirements. Consider the games you enjoy playing and whether the bonus can be used on those games. Also, check the time limit for meeting the wagering requirements; if it’s too short, you may not have enough time to fulfill the conditions. Ultimately, a valuable bonus is one that offers a reasonable chance of winning and allows you to enjoy your gaming experience without undue pressure.

Payment Methods and Financial Security

Choosing secure payment methods is paramount when engaging in online gaming. Reputable platforms offer a variety of payment options, including credit cards, debit cards, e-wallets (such as P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ller), and bank transfers. When using a credit or debit card, ensure that the platform uses SSL encryption to protect your card details. E-wallets provide an additional layer of security by acting as intermediaries between your bank account and the gaming platform. They conceal your financial information from the platform, reducing the risk of fraud. It’s important to understand the transaction fees associated with each payment method.

Always be cautious of platforms that request sensitive information, such as your Social Security number or bank PIN. Legitimate platforms will never ask for this type of information. Reviewing the platform's withdrawal policy is crucial before making a deposit. Understand how long it takes to process withdrawals, the minimum withdrawal amount, and any associated fees.
